
As we previously reported, it looks like the rumors are true. Coachella 2020 has been officially been postponed until October due to the Corona Virus / COVID-19 outbreak. Hopefully, the new Coachella dates will take place Oct. 9, 10, and 11, and October 16, 17 and 18, 2020. Stagecoach will now take place Oct. 23, 24 and 25, 2020. All purchased Coachella tickets will be honored for the new October dates. Attendees who can no longer make the new dates will be notified by Friday, March 13 on how to obtain a refund.
The first major music event to go was SXSW when they official announced their 2020 cancelation. It was the first in 34 years. Now joining the list of music festivals and conferences is Coachella (postponed).

Coachella 2020 was supposed take place April 10th-12th and April 17th-19th at the Empire Polo Club in Indio, California. The 2020 Coachella lineup is to feature: Thom Yorke, Lana Del Rey, Flume, Rage Against the Machine, Frank Ocean, Travis Scott, FKA Twigs, Run The Jewels, Caribou, Denzel Curry, King Gizzard & The Lizard Wizard, Chicano Batman, Duck Sauce, Fatboy Slim, Megan Thee Stallion, IDLES, Pink Sweat$, Weyes Blood, Princess Nokia, TOKiMONSTA, beabadoobee, The Regrettes, Girl In Red, Bedouin, Bishop Briggs, Noname, Altin Gün, Sampa The Great, Big Wild, Friendly Fires, Amber Mark, Hot Chip, Carly Rae Jepsen, Seun Kuti & Egypt 80, and more.
